用N—甲酰吗啉萃取精馏分离苯加氢油中的烷烃

摘    要:通过对苯加氢油萃取精馏溶剂性能的比较表明,N-甲酰吗啉在选择性、热稳定性、化学稳定性、腐蚀性和毒性等均优于其他溶剂,可作为分离焦化苯加氢油中微量烷烃的优良溶剂。

Separation of Alkane from Hydrorefining Raffinate Using N-formylmorpholine with Extractive Distillation Process

Abstract:The comparison of the properties of solvents for hydrorefining raffinate extractive distillation shows that N-formylmorpholine is better than the other solvents in selection , thermal stability,chemical stability, corrosion toxicity and so on. It is a better solvent for the separation of trace alkane from the hydrorefining raffinate.
